The Science Behind PRP and Scalp Inflammation
Platelet-rich plasma (PRP) therapy is a regenerative treatment that uses concentrated platelets from the patient’s own blood to promote healing. Platelets contain growth factors that play a crucial role in tissue repair, collagen production, and reducing inflammation. When injected into the scalp, these growth factors help modulate the immune response, calming irritated tissues and creating a healthier environment for hair follicles.
How Inflammation Affects Hair Health
Chronic scalp inflammation can disrupt the hair growth cycle, leading to conditions like alopecia, folliculitis, or seborrheic dermatitis. Inflammation damages hair follicles, weakens strands, and accelerates shedding. Traditional treatments often focus on symptom relief, but PRP addresses the root cause by promoting cellular regeneration and reducing inflammatory triggers.
The Role of PRP in Reducing Scalp Inflammation
PRP therapy works through multiple pathways to alleviate scalp inflammation and encourage hair regrowth:
Anti-Inflammatory Effects
The growth factors in PRP, such as TGF-β and VEGF, help regulate the immune system’s response, reducing the production of pro-inflammatory cytokines. This calms irritated scalp tissues and prevents further damage to hair follicles.
Improved Blood Circulation
Inflammation often restricts blood flow to hair follicles, depriving them of essential nutrients. PRP stimulates angiogenesis (the formation of new blood vessels), ensuring better oxygen and nutrient delivery to the scalp.
Strengthening Hair Follicles
By promoting collagen synthesis and cellular repair, PRP reinforces weakened follicles, making them more resilient to inflammation-induced damage. This results in thicker, healthier hair over time.

The PRP Hair Treatment Process
The procedure for PRP hair treatment is straightforward and minimally invasive, making it a convenient option for those seeking relief from scalp inflammation.
Step 1: Blood Extraction
A small amount of blood is drawn from the patient’s arm, similar to a routine blood test.
Step 2: Centrifugation
The blood is placed in a centrifuge machine, which separates the platelet-rich plasma from other blood components.
Step 3: Scalp Preparation
The treatment area is cleaned, and a topical numbing agent may be applied for comfort.
Step 4: PRP Injection
The concentrated PRP is injected into the inflamed areas of the scalp using fine needles. The growth factors immediately begin working to reduce inflammation and stimulate healing.
Step 5: Post-Treatment Care
Patients can resume normal activities immediately, though strenuous exercise and excessive sun exposure should be avoided for 24-48 hours.
Who Can Benefit from PRP for Scalp Inflammation?
PRP hair treatment is suitable for individuals experiencing:
Chronic scalp redness, itching, or flaking
Hair thinning due to inflammatory conditions
Early-stage androgenetic alopecia
Post-inflammatory hair loss from dermatitis or infections
However, those with blood disorders, active infections, or certain autoimmune conditions should consult a specialist before undergoing treatment.
